Default Cost of complete interior?

I saw a wrecked 99 monte for sale on craigslist and I was thinking about calling the guy up and seeing what he wants to part out the interior. I soo want an all black interior. It's got 114K on it and all leather. If the interior is in decent condition, how much should I expect to pay? I have no real idea how much a complete interior should go for. Complete meaning seats, carpet, trim pieces, headliner.. all of it minus dash basically.

I would say 200 to 300 or so sounds fair to me. See what the seller wants to get for it all tho. If he wants too much maybe compromise and just get the seats and trim. Then you could dye your carpet and headliner. Maybe he want want too much for the whole car. Then take what you need and scrap the rest. Oh and make sure you pull the parts or are there when he pulls them.
